It seems appropriate to mention that, under Bernard Desgraupes tender ministrations, Alpha continues to go from strength to strength, including now  both spell checking and its own pdf viewer.

A little more than a year ago, I switched to Sublime Text for all my LaTeX'ing and haven't looked back. With LaTeXTools installed, you have a LaTeX-aware editor spell checker built in. And it has so many other cool LaTeX features.
